Sinjeon Topokki, a popular restaurant chain in Seoul known for its Korean street food is opening in Kuwait today (August 1st).
Sinjeon Topokki began in 1999 as a small, humble food stand in South Korea. Since then, it has grown into a global phenomenon with over 700 branches worldwide, and the Kuwait location will be their first in the Middle East.
Although we have quite a few Korean restaurants in Kuwait already, what will set Sinjeon apart is the topokki. If you’ve never had it before, they’re small cylinder-shaped rice noodles which I like to describe as the Korean version of gnocchi (Don’t unfollow me for this!). They’ll have 4 different bases (sauces) for you to pick from, and you can also choose to add different veggies and proteins to it. In addition to topokki they do have traditional Korean dishes on the menu including bibimbap, noodles, and curries.
